BWW Previews: WHO'S HOLIDAY! at Human Race Theatre
by Irene Imboden - Nov 29, 2021


If playwright Matthew Lombardo's searing look at actress Tallulah Bankhead in Looped was the main course, then his spicy confection about Cindy Lou Who in Who's Holiday! - playing this December at The Human Race - is the decadent dessert we have been waiting for. Called a 'raunchy riff on Dr. Seuss,' Who's Holiday! is a wildly funny and heartfelt adult-only comedy about grown-up Cindy Lou Who, as she recalls that Christmas Eve when she first met the Grinch and the twisted turn of events her life has since taken. Who's Holiday! will fill the Loft Theatre with laughter, December 2 - 19, 2021.

Kevin Moore Will Retire As Artistic Director of The Human Race Theatre Company
by A.A. Cristi - Jul 9, 2021


The Human Race Theatre Company announces that Artistic Director, Kevin Moore, will retire from the company that he helped to found in June, 2022 – at the end of his 36th year in leadership at Dayton's premier professional theatre company.
